The clear walls of the egg chamber mean fantastic visibility of the hatching eggs without lifting the lid and the fan-assisted design coupled with detailed airflow analysis results in exceptionally even heating of the eggs to ensure consistent and reliable hatches. Two disks are available, one for 14 eggs of all sizes up to duck (supplied as standard) and a second small egg disk holding 40 eggs up to the size of pheasant is available as an optional extra. Humidity is provided for with central water reservoirs with convenient external top-up and eggs are turned by rotating egg disks. Opening the menu allows the user to adjust incubation temperature, the unit (☌ or ☏), turning interval, turning angle, number of days your eggs take to hatch, cooling duration and high and low temperature alarm limits. In normal operation the display shows incubation temperature, days to hatch and turning status. ![]() ![]() The Maxi II Advance incorporates digital micro-control which allows the user to manage incubator functions via a simple menu on the digital display. The IKE phase 1 tunnel is only used for management traffic. Here’s an example of two routers that have established the IKE phase 1 tunnel: The collection of parameters that the two devices will use is called a SA (Security Association). This is also called the ISAKMP tunnel or IKE phase 1 tunnel. In this phase, an ISAKMP (Internet Security Association and Key Management Protocol) session is established. In IKE phase 1, two peers will negotiate about the encryption, authentication, hashing and other protocols that they want to use and some other parameters that are required. The cabin itself is elegant but is very plain. Each first class seat measures 22 inches wide and converts to a fully-flat bed 79 inches long (6 feet 7 inches). The individual suites are not the most private but they are very spacious. The cabin is configured with 14 open suites in a 1-1-1 layout. On their Airbus A380 fleet, the first class cabin is located in the forward cabin of the lower deck.
